Web24 nov. 2024 · Step 3: To Sanitize The Jars, Submerge Them In Boiling Water For 10 Minutes. In order to sanitize glass jars, submerge them in boiling water for 10 minutes. This will help to remove any dirt or debris that may be on the surface of the jars, as well as kill any bacteria that could potentially contaminate your food. Web18 jan. 2024 · To truly sterilize canning jars for food safety, the NCHFP recommends you use the boiling water method. This requires fully submerging jars in water and boiling for 10 minutes (if you live in an area of 0-1,000 feet elevation). For those that live at higher altitudes, you’ll need to add 1 additional minute per 1,000 feet of elevation. WebFor each additional 1,000 feet, add an extra minute to the overall boiling time. Remove clean jars from the water bath canner using a jar lifter. Drain the hot water back into the canner to use later for processing the filled …
